Hello
I creaeted an exceedingly simple mashup script:
function bar() {
return "ok";
}
Saved in a javascript named foo.js.
Invoke the tryit for the mashup with the url
http://localhost:7762/services/block_repo/foo?tryit and click the bar>>
button, I get the following message:
Fault: Permission denied to call method XMLHttpRequest.open [detail]
Internal Error
The error does not occur when the service is invoked over the SSL
connection.
